On Fri, 2003-09-12 at 14:02, Christian Marillat wrote: > > I've seen lots of good comments from regular users like myself about > > ways to handle the Gnome 2.4 situation, but I have yet to see any > > comments from the key Debian Gnome maintainers (Christian comes to mind :-). > > For now I don't intent to package GNOME 2.4 for unstable because we > have a broken 2.2 in testing and I don't intent to upload my GNOME 2.4 > package to experimental because, I don't use experimental and I don't > intent to use experimental.
As much as I respect you as a packager, we need to do something with
GNOME 2.4. Sitting on our hands until 2.2 has migrated into testing
instead of testing 2.4 *whilst* 2.2 migrates is not an option, as we'll
just be wasting our time.
Experimental is there for Debian Developers to test software, and the
GNOME 2.4 release needs it. I'm willing to NMU your packages into
experimental to help the process along, whilst GNOME 2.2 is coerced into
testing.
